Last night, I noticed a little pain in my incision area. I am five months pregnant and would rather have a vbac than another Cbirth. Have you had incision pain during pregnancy and then gone on to have a vbac? I don't want to mention it to my doctor just yet (though I most likely will) because she may jump the gun and say I should have another Cbirth. Thanks.

According to ICAN those pains are just adhesions breaking apart from the stretching--nothing dangerous, and not a sign of internal tearing or ripping. You might want to join the ICAN mailing list for more details. It's definitely NOT a reason for another c/s!!!!!!!

hi Julie. I had some pain in the incision area throughout my second pregnancy. I did, unfortunately go on to have a second c/s, but it was not due to this. I talked to the doctor about it, and she said that it was completely normal and would not be a problem to consider when having a VBAC.Good luck to you.

Five years ago I gave birth via c-sec. Two years ago I had a vaginal birth (at home). I also had a certain amount of pain and discomfort in the area of my scar during the last pregnancy. In fact as I type this my incision is still uncomfortable although it is no longer constant as it was for the first nine months.

My OB told me that it was the scar tissue stretching...that it has nerve endings and that it is sensitive.
I DEFINITELY had pain in mine - a lot, actually. It was SO uncomfortable - especially once she started kicking.
But, we went on to have a VERY good VBAC experience with no rupture or any problems whatsoever!
